Are you interested in emergency pre-hospital care? SBIE, the institution that established healthcare professions in Greece, offers the most comprehensive training program for the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) – Ambulance Crew specialty.

As a trainee EMT – Ambulance Crew Member, you will acquire all the necessary knowledge and hands-on experience required to effectively and swiftly handle critical and life-threatening situations before and during patient transport.

As part of pre-hospital care, before the patient or injured person reaches an organized healthcare facility, the EMT or ambulance crew must relay essential information about the patient’s condition to the Emergency Response Center and follow the instructions provided via wireless communication. Additionally, EMTs must undergo specialized training to recognize and manage acute medical emergencies, accidents, and more, while performing life-saving interventions under guidance, such as c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R), airway management, defibrillation, fracture immobilization, oxygen administration, IV therapy, and medication administration.

Upon completing their studies at SBIE, graduates of the EMT – Ambulance Crew program are fully qualified to ensure the safe transport of patients and injured individuals to healthcare facilities.

Career Rehabilitation -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) – Ambulance Crew

Emergency Medical Technicians (EMTs) and ambulance crew members staff mobile medical units, floating and aerial patient transport vehicles, emergency response coordination centers, disaster response teams, and, of course, ambulance vehicles for hospitals and clinics, such as EKAV (Greek Ambulance Service), among others.
